Asahi Beverages is one of the leading beverage companies in Australia and New Zealand with a rich and varied history. Comprising some of Australia and New Zealand's most loved brands, the company's Regional Hub is based in Melbourne with three Business Divisions - Asahi Lifestyle Beverages (formerly Schweppes Australia), Carlton & United Breweries (CUB) in Australia; and Asahi Beverages NZ and The Better Drinks Co. in New Zealand.
